The SAFETY INSURANCE COMPANY 401(k) on its latest Form 5500

SAFETY INSURANCE COMPANY (EIN 04-2689624) reports SAFETY INSURANCE COMPANY 401K RETIREMENT PLAN on its most recent Form 5500, with $205.8M in plan assets across 612 active participants. Form 5500 is the annual report employers file with the U.S. Department of Labor for their retirement plans, and it’s public.

Who runs the SAFETY INSURANCE COMPANY 401(k)?

The plan’s recordkeeper — the firm that runs the website and statements where you check your balance, change contributions, and manage your account — is Fidelity, based on the plan’s Schedule C service-provider disclosure. That’s the login you use for your SAFETY INSURANCE COMPANY 401(k).

Other service providers named on the filing (investment managers, trustees, auditors — not necessarily the recordkeeper): STRATEGIC ADVISORS.
